Past projects proved EGNOS benefits for Rail & Maritime need to be further developed

• Rail & Maritime remain two important user communities

• SoL regulated applications have long lead times (e.g. certification)

Page 4: 1 EU funding for sustainable energy Use of EGNOS for Safety-of-Life Applications: Rail & Maritime

4

This project is addressing EGNOS SoL use and preparation to Galileo

• Main objectives are: • To advance on past work and tackle

roadblocks, propose solutions• Finalize a roadmap for SoL service introduction• Have real life demo proving concepts

• Other objectives:• Analyse cost and benefits of EGNOS/Galileo• Preliminary business cases from public/private

perspective

FAQ 1/3

• Where do you see the R&D value of this project ?Tackling the unresolved issues highlighted in past projects by propose innovative technical solutions

• Is it a continuation of past projects, like GRAIL/MARUSE (i.e. same concept) ?

Questions/issues raised by previous research should be reviewed and solutions provided. New approaches are welcome, if proved to be more effective (e.g., to tackle open issues along the whole value chain, including regulatory ones)

• Do you expect a well-written report ?Yes but also real-life demos as proof of concepts/solutions proposed

• Project specifications • Duration: up to 24 months• Collaborative project (you’ll have to match 50% of the total budget)

Page 6: 1 EU funding for sustainable energy Use of EGNOS for Safety-of-Life Applications: Rail & Maritime

6

FAQ 2/3

• I run past FP Rail and/or Maritime related project, do I have an advantage here ?Selection will be strictly based on the merits of the proposal and capability of the consortium, independently of past participation on similar research

• Do you focus more on rail or maritime ?The two are relevant. Most innovative/impactful proposal will win

• Who would be the ideal consortium’s members ?Public and private organization that can tackle all the open issues along the entire chain of operations

Page 7: 1 EU funding for sustainable energy Use of EGNOS for Safety-of-Life Applications: Rail & Maritime

7

FAQ 3/3

• Is there any geographical focus ? Pan-European trials (i.e., cross-border) will be most welcome

• Is it a continuation of past projects, like GRAIL/MARUSE (i.e. can I repackage past work :-) ?We do not want to duplicate/replicate past work, though we shall build on the knowledge created by past investments

• Do I need a business plan in my proposal? Yes,we do not intend to finance proposals with no perspectives

• I didn’t quite get what do you expect out of spending this moneyList of SoL Rail or Maritime applications that can be realistically pursued (having tested feasibility) and a program plan on how to get them adopted
